by fstarcstar » Tue Feb 24, 2015 1:54 pm
Hit up Greece, Italy, Norway or Germany.
Greece - despite political turmoil I bet its cheap to go there for tourists.
Italy - I mean, why not?
Germany - Rhine rivers, castles, history etc.
Norway - amazing summers, good lakes and forests etc.
I've been to Costa Rica and Belize in the last two years and haven't been very impressed honestly.